19-year-old Jeremiah Nickens of Windsor, KY was heading westbound on Highway 80 in the Royville community, operating a white 2016 GMC Sierra, when he lost control of the vehicle, ran off the road and hit an electric pole, causing the vehicle to flip. The force of the impact broke the electric pole, knocking it down along with breaking multiple lines. Several residents were without power for over an hour until SKRECC could restore service.
Jeremiah was transported to Russell County Hospital by Russell County EMS with lacerations to his head, along with other cuts and scratches.
Assisting at the scene was the Russell Springs Fire Department, EMS, SKRECC Linemen, and property owners who provided first aid.
Deputy Chad Fox is the investigating officer.
